Arkime (ex Moloch) Pros and Cons

Image
  Pros : Scalability : Arkime is designed to handle large-scale environments and can efficiently capture, store, and analyze massive amounts of network traffic data. Full Packet Capture : Arkime provides full packet capture, allowing for in-depth analysis of network traffic and enabling effective threat hunting and incident response. Indexing and Searching : The system indexes captured data, making it easy to search and retrieve information quickly using various search criteria, such as IP addresses, ports, protocols, and more. Customizable Retention Policies : Arkime allows users to define retention policies, specifying how long data should be stored, which helps manage storage resources effectively. Open-Source and Community Support : Arkime is an open-source project with an active community.
